Medan Putra Condominium in Kuala Lumpur, Kuala Lumpur recorded 9 subsale transactions between 2021 and 2026, sized between 1,075 and 1,124 sqft, with a median price of RM380K and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M353.

This area consists exclusively of residential properties, with no commercial listings recorded.

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M380K,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M368K to RM392K, and a typical market range of RM363K to RM393K.

Most transactions involved condominium/apartment, with minimal variety in property types.

For price per square foot, the median is RM353, with most transactions between RM342 and RM364. The usual range is RM336.16 to RM369.91, showing that most units are priced quite close to each other. A typical spread (IQR) of RM33.75 and an average deviation (MAD) of RM11 indicate a highly stable PSF trend across properties.
